




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領
文檔簡介
1、操作系統(tǒng)復習大綱1 設置操作系統(tǒng)的目的答:1.向用戶提供方便、簡單的實用計算機的環(huán)境;2.使計算機系統(tǒng)能搞笑地工作,提高系統(tǒng)資源的利用率2 操作系統(tǒng)的定義、功能、類型、特征答:定義:計算機操作系統(tǒng)是方便用戶實用,管理和控制計算機軟硬件資源的系統(tǒng)軟件功能:處理機管理(進程控制、進程調(diào)度、進程同步、進程通信)、存儲器管理(內(nèi)存分配、存儲保護、存儲擴充)、設備管理(設備分配、設備傳輸控制、設備無關性)、文件管理(文件存儲空間管理、目錄管理、文件保護、文件操作管理)和作業(yè)管理(用戶接口、程序接口)操作系統(tǒng)的特征:并發(fā)、共享、虛擬、異步(不確定性)類型:批處理系統(tǒng):(特征:成批處理、多道程序運行,用戶脫
2、機使用計算機)單道批處理:FMS(FORTRAN監(jiān)控系統(tǒng))、IBYSY(IBM/7094)多道批處理:IBM 360/370分時系統(tǒng):(特征:多路性、獨占性、及時性、交互性)Unix、VAX/VMX、CTSS、MUTICS等實時系統(tǒng)(即時響應、高可靠性、專業(yè)性)單用戶系統(tǒng)單用戶單任務:CP/M,MS-DOS單用戶多任務:windows多用戶多任務:UNIX OS,Linux OS網(wǎng)絡系統(tǒng):(特征:網(wǎng)絡通信、資源共享、互操作、協(xié)作處理)Windows NT Server、NetWare,2000分布式系統(tǒng)(特征:統(tǒng)一性、堅強性)3 多道程序設計與并發(fā)性4 進程的定義、特征以及組成(PCB)5 線
3、程與進程6 進程的基本狀態(tài)及其轉(zhuǎn)換7 臨界資源、臨界區(qū)8 互斥,同步9 用信號量和p、v操作實現(xiàn)進程的互斥和同步10 處理機的分級調(diào)度,作業(yè)調(diào)度和進程調(diào)度的主要任務11 常用的調(diào)度算法12 產(chǎn)生死鎖的原因、必要條件和解決死鎖的方法。13 地址重定位及分頁地址變換過程14 分區(qū)式、分頁式、分段式存儲管理原理15 分區(qū)式存儲管理的分配16 虛擬存儲器17 頁面淘汰算法18 設備的分類的特點19 緩沖技術20 設備的分配與設備的獨立性21 磁盤的驅(qū)動調(diào)度22 文件的物理結(jié)構(gòu)、邏輯結(jié)構(gòu)和存取方法23 文件目錄管理(作用、特點)24 文件存儲空間的管理方法25 文件基本操作及作用26 操作系統(tǒng)接口的類型
4、、形式和作用27 系統(tǒng)功能調(diào)用操作系統(tǒng)練習題一、 單項選擇題(每小題2分,共30分)1、文件是按( A )存取的。 A.名 B.地址 C.路徑 2、實時操作系統(tǒng)最關鍵的因素是( A )。 A.系統(tǒng)安全性 B.資源利用率 C.用戶交互能力 3、保存進程狀態(tài),控制進程轉(zhuǎn)換的標志是( B )。 A.程序 B.進程控制塊 C.數(shù)據(jù)集合 4、不允許多個并發(fā)進程交叉執(zhí)行的一段程序是( A )。A.臨界區(qū) B.臨界資源 C.共享變量5、下列設備屬于獨占設備的是( B )。 A.磁盤 B.打印機 C.假脫機 6、系統(tǒng)與設備間的協(xié)調(diào)主要是( A )上的協(xié)調(diào)。 A.速度 B.存儲空間 C.中斷 7、文件的存儲空間
5、管理實際上是對( C )空間的管理 A.內(nèi)存 B.硬盤 C.外存 8、虛擬存儲器( C )。A.是為了擴充內(nèi)存而完全利用軟件設置的虛假的存儲器。B.提高了系統(tǒng)的并行性和程序的執(zhí)行速度。C.包括請求頁式存儲管理、請求段式存儲管理和請求段頁式存儲管理9、從就緒隊列中選擇一個處理機執(zhí)行時間預期最短的進程,將處理機分配給它的算法是( B )。 A.先進先出調(diào)度算法 B. 短執(zhí)行進程優(yōu)先調(diào)度算法 C.時間片輪轉(zhuǎn)法 10、下面是關于重定位的有關描述,其中錯誤的是( C )。A.靜態(tài)重定位中裝入內(nèi)存的作業(yè)仍保持原來的邏輯地址。B.用戶程序中使用的從0地址開始的地址編號為邏輯地址。C.動態(tài)重定位中裝入內(nèi)存的作
6、業(yè)仍保持原來的邏輯地址。11、不允許兩個并發(fā)進程同時進入同一臨界區(qū)的進程關系叫( A )。A.互斥 B.同步 C.制約關系12、在操作系統(tǒng)中,對信號量S的P原語操作定義中,使進程進入相應阻塞隊列等待的條件是( C )。A.S > 0 B.S = 0 C.S < 0 13、在操作系統(tǒng)中,用戶在使用I/O設備時,通常采用( B )。A.物理設備名 B.邏輯設備名 C.虛擬設備名 14、使用戶所編制的程序與實際使用的物理設備無關,這是由設備管理的( A )功能實現(xiàn)的。 A.設備獨立性 B.設備分配 C.虛擬設備15、進程所請求的一次打印輸出結(jié)束后,將使進程狀態(tài)從( B )。 A.運行態(tài)變
7、為就緒態(tài) B.等待態(tài)變?yōu)榫途w態(tài) C.就緒態(tài)變?yōu)檫\行態(tài)二、填空題(每空1分,共15分)1、操作系統(tǒng)在計算機系統(tǒng)中位于 和 之間。2、設置操作系統(tǒng)的目的既要 ,又要 ,它具有如下功能: 、 、 、 、 。3、程序順序執(zhí)行有兩個重要的特點,即程序的 和程序的 。4、進程的實體由 、 和 三部分組成。5、分區(qū)式存儲管理有 和 兩種方式。6、從I/O操作的信息傳輸單位來講,設備可分為 和 。7、緩沖技術可以采用 和 兩種方式。1、硬件 其它系統(tǒng)軟件 2、提高系統(tǒng)資源利用率 方便用戶使用計算機 處理機管理 存儲器管理 設備管理 文件管理 用戶接口 3、封閉性 可再現(xiàn)性 4、程序 數(shù)據(jù) 進程控制塊(PCB)
8、 5、固定分區(qū)/靜態(tài)分區(qū) 可變分區(qū)/動態(tài)分區(qū) 6、字符設備 塊設備 7、 硬緩沖 軟緩沖 三、簡答題(每小題5分,共25分)1、 進程調(diào)度產(chǎn)生的因素有哪些?2、 為什么說分段系統(tǒng)比分頁系統(tǒng)更易于實現(xiàn)信息的共享和保護?3、 實現(xiàn)虛擬設備后,從哪些方面提高了系統(tǒng)效率?4、目前OS中廣泛采用的文件目錄結(jié)構(gòu)形式是哪一種? 它有什么特點?5、通常在用戶和OS之間提供了哪幾種類型的接口?它們的主要功能是什么?四、應用題(每小題10分,共30分)1、 一個采用頁式虛擬存儲管理的系統(tǒng)中,有一用戶作業(yè),它依次要訪問的字地址序列是:115,228,120,88,446,102,321,432,260,167,若該
9、作業(yè)的第0頁已經(jīng)裝入主存,現(xiàn)分配給該作業(yè)的主存共300字節(jié),頁的大小為100字節(jié),請回答下列問題:1) 按FIFO頁面淘汰算法將產(chǎn)生多少次缺頁中斷,依次淘汰的頁號是什么,缺頁中斷率是多少?2) 按LRU頁面淘汰算法將產(chǎn)生多少次缺頁中斷,依次淘汰的頁號是什么,缺頁中斷率是多少?解:300字主存,頁的大小為100字,則分配給該作業(yè)的頁面數(shù)為3。由于頁的大小為100字,頁號= int邏輯地址/頁長,所以字地址序列:115,228,120,88,446,102,321,432,260,167依次對應的頁地址序列是:1,2,1,0,4,1,3,4,2,1,(1) 按FIFO調(diào)度算法:×
10、15; 0 1 21,2,1,0,4,1,3,4,2,1,0 0 0 0 1 1 2 2 2 41 1 1 1 2 2 4 4 4 32 2 2 4 4 3 3 3 1 按FIFO調(diào)度算法,將產(chǎn)生5次缺頁中斷,依次淘汰的頁號是0、1、2缺頁中斷率是:f = (缺頁中斷次數(shù))/(訪問的頁面總數(shù))×100%= 5/10×100% = 50% (2) 按LRU調(diào)度算法:× × 2 0 1 31,2,1,0,4,1,3,4,2,1,0 0 0 2 1 0 4 1 3 41 1 2 1 0 4 1 3 4 22 1 0 4 1 3 4 2 1 按LRU調(diào)度算法,將
11、產(chǎn)生6次缺頁中斷,依次淘汰的頁號是2、0、1、3缺頁中斷率是:f = (缺頁中斷次數(shù))/(訪問的頁面總數(shù))×100%= 6/10×100% = 60% 2、在某虛擬存儲器的用戶空間共32個頁面,每頁1KB,主存為16 KB。假定某時刻系統(tǒng)為用戶的第0、1、2、3頁分別分配到物理塊號為5、10、4、7中,試將虛擬地址0A5C(H)和093C(H)變換為物理地址,并畫圖說明地址轉(zhuǎn)換的過程。3、某運動隊有若干名教練員和若干名運動員,教練員指導運動員訓練,教練員每次發(fā)出一條訓練指令,插入消息鏈,運動員每次從消息鏈上取下一條指令并按指令執(zhí)行訓練。用P,V操作原語實現(xiàn)教練員和運動員之間
12、的同步。8答: begin mutex, s :semaphore; mutex:=1; s:=0; T:消息鏈頭指針; cobegin process 教練員i begin repeat P(mutex); 將指令插入消息鏈T; V(mutex); V(s) Until false end Process 運動員j begin repeat P(s); P(mutex) 從消息鏈T中取下指令; V(mutex); 執(zhí)行指令; until false end coend end9答: begin empty, f1,f2 :semaphore; empty:=1; f1:=f2:=0; cobegin Process 教練員 begin repeat 準備訓練指令;P(empty); 將訓練指令寫到公告板; if 給運動員1的訓練指令 the
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025外匯質(zhì)押人民幣貸款合同范本
- 民間資金借款抵押合同
- 藥材種植協(xié)議書范本
- 2025商業(yè)混凝土銷售合同范本
- 婚后貸款協(xié)議書范本
- 藏獒轉(zhuǎn)賣協(xié)議書模板
- 2025年03月河北邯鄲武安市事業(yè)單位春季博碩人才引進55名筆試歷年典型考題(歷年真題考點)解題思路附帶答案詳解
- 2025年03月新疆阿勒泰地區(qū)吉木乃縣紅十字會招募紅十字志愿者筆試歷年典型考題(歷年真題考點)解題思路附帶答案詳解
- Unit 9 From Here to There 第三課時Developing the Topic(含答案)仁愛版2024七下英語日清限時練
- 武漢鐵路職業(yè)技術學院《智能機器人》2023-2024學年第二學期期末試卷
- 2024年廣東省萬閱大灣區(qū)百校聯(lián)盟中考一模數(shù)學試題
- 《短視頻拍攝與制作》課件-3短視頻中期拍攝
- 數(shù)字貿(mào)易學 課件 馬述忠 第13-22章 數(shù)字貿(mào)易綜合服務概述- 數(shù)字貿(mào)易規(guī)則構(gòu)建與WTO新一輪電子商務談判
- 2024年電路保護元器件行業(yè)營銷策略方案
- 污泥技術污泥運輸方案
- 年產(chǎn)3.5萬噸丙烯腈合成工段工藝設計課程設計
- 【方案】分布式光伏項目勘察及建設方案
- 半導體行業(yè)對國家國防戰(zhàn)略的支撐與應用
- 智能點滴自動監(jiān)控方法設計
- 辦學許可證續(xù)期申請書
- Cpk及Ppk計算電子表格模板
評論
0/150
提交評論